Neiman Marcus has 79 stores and reported total sales of $1.1 billion in Q4 2013. The high-end retailer confirmed a data breach that could represent a risk its customers. The company is working with the U.S. Secret Service to investigate a hacker break-in that has exposed an unknown number of customer cards. The incident occurs a few weeks after the clamorous data breach at US giant retailer Target. Cybersecurity expert Brian Krebs confirmed a surge in fraudulent credit and debit charges on cards that had been used at Neiman.”]
